Four concrete levers

Speed · Sovereignty · Independence · Predictable costs

Operational speed

Reduced time on document, decisional and delivery processes. Scale without hiring. Qualified output instead of manual iterations.

Data sovereignty

Data stays inside the corporate perimeter. Models run on-premise or on the client's cloud. Zero leak to external training pipelines.

Provider independence

Architectures that decouple the organization from LLM vendors. Model swappability without rewriting the application.

Predictable costs

Operational ceiling on inference costs. No end-of-month surprises on API tokens. Amortizable hardware capex.
